In today’s fast-paced world, giving takes many forms, from financial donations to volunteering one’s time and energy. While both have value, I think there is a key distinction: money is a renewable resource—you can earn, spend, and regain it—whereas time and energy, once given, are irreplaceable. That’s why true acts of service, those requiring personal effort and commitment, often create deeper connections and fulfilment, triggering the release of oxytocin.
